Strong open-weights release that stops one notch short of full openness: permissive Apache-2.0 weights plus the complete training code/recipe published on GitHub, but the pretraining corpus is only documented (60+ named sources) rather than released or reconstructable. That missing open-data component is the bright line that keeps it at open_weights (4) rather than the OLMo/Pythia/Apertus open_source (5) tier, where Apertus reaches 5 by shipping data-reconstruction scripts. No intermediate checkpoints.
